Analysis
Sweden recorded 3,320 Tonnes of CO2-equivalent for agricultural greenhouse gases emissions — enteric fermentation in 2023.
That represents a change of up 0.1% on the previous year and down 2.0% over ten years.
Over the whole period, agricultural greenhouse gases emissions — enteric fermentation in Sweden peaked at 3,899 Tonnes of CO2-equivalent in 1994 and was at its lowest, 3,305 Tonnes of CO2-equivalent, in 2020.
Sweden ranks 30th of 40 countries on this measure, in the middle of the range.
The long-run direction has been consistently falling across the 34 years of available data.
